Racing Titans Clash: Will Jack Link’s 500 Break Handpicked Leaders’ Dominance at Talladega?

NASCAR’s Next Gen Era Faces Domination by Handpicked Leaders as Veterans Sound the Alarm

As the roar of engines echoes through the NASCAR tracks, a dominant force is emerging in the form of handpicked leaders ready to seize control. The veterans of the sport are predicting a shift in the tides as the glory days of the Next Gen era seem to be coming to an end.

In a recent race at Bristol, Denny Hamlin, a seasoned driver from Joe Gibbs Racing, boldly stated, “You’re just going to have the best guys winning.” Hamlin himself is part of the elite group of drivers who have clinched multiple victories this season, alongside his teammate Christopher Bell, who has been on a winning spree at Atlanta, COTA, and Phoenix. Bell’s three consecutive wins in the Next-Gen era are a testament to the changing landscape of NASCAR racing.

The introduction of the Gen-7 car in 2022 was aimed at leveling the playing field, allowing drivers with varying levels of experience to excel. However, as the season progresses, it is evident that certain drivers are once again asserting their dominance over the rest of the pack.

The 2022 season saw a record-breaking 19 different winners in 29 races, showcasing a newfound parity in the field. Yet, as the 2025 season unfolds, a noticeable shift is occurring, with drivers like Bell, Hamlin, and Kyle Larson showcasing their prowess on the track. With Bell’s impressive three-peat, Hamlin’s victories at Martinsville and Darlington, and Larson’s domination in Homestead and Bristol, experts are anticipating a season dictated by these select leaders.

NASCAR veteran Kyle Petty reminisced about the days when the prospect of numerous drivers gracing Victory Lane was a common occurrence. However, with the current trend favoring powerhouse teams like Joe Gibbs Racing, who have seen remarkable success with strategic pit stops and technical prowess, the likelihood of a streak by the frontrunners seems inevitable.

Looking ahead to the upcoming race at Talladega, anticipation is running high as fans wonder if this event will break the leaders’ winning streak. The superspeedway oval has a rich history of producing unexpected winners, adding an element of unpredictability to the competition. With a new sponsor, Jack Link’s, taking the reins for the spring race, the excitement is palpable as drivers gear up for the Jack Link’s 500.

As the NASCAR Cup Series season unfolds, the battle for supremacy among the handpicked leaders is set to intensify. The stage is set for a showdown of epic proportions, where only the best will emerge victorious in the ever-evolving landscape of NASCAR racing.
